No way to transfer miis in Tomodachi Life: Living the Dream? No problem!
Much like the rest of y'all, the news of TL's newest installment having limited online features sorta bummed me out; I get it, Nintendo does not want to be associated with the inevitable mass-creation of Charmii Kirks, but, nevertheless, that does put a wrench in our plans, no? I mean, who even has the time (or attention span, really) to recreate their best Shadow the Hedgehog miis from scratch like it's 2008 again?
Well... it actually doesn't have to be that way.
In the year of Satan 2026, the mii community has come a long way since the debut of these little fellas on the wii. As technology progresses, so did the myriad of ways one could archive these adorable avatars! One such method that is currently out there is none other than Miiport!
The program is as simple as it gets; you install it on your handy-dandy switch/emulator, import/export miis into .charinfo files, and voila; your mii has been backed up! Now you'll be free to host these files on whatever site you wish to archive them in and share them with the world!
My favorite part, of course, is that this means I am no longer limited to having 100 Miis on a technicality :D Reached your cap sooner than you expected? No problem; just make sure all your miis are exported to a folder/external drive as safely as you could, and you won't ever have to worry about losing them- so long as you are careful, of course :3
One issue that I have faced while utilizing it, however, is that one needs a "Mii QR Key" if the raw mii data itself is not available. So far, I haven't found much luck looking for one, but I am certain that the lots of you possess higher chances at doing so. c:
